JERRY VAN HOUTEN EARNS ACCREDITED INVESTMENT FIDUCIARY DESIGNATION FROM Fi360
Riverbank, CA January 21, 2018 Jerry Van Houten of American Asset & Wealth Management has been awarded the Accredited Investment Fiduciary® (AIF®) designation from the Center for Fiduciary Studies®, the standards-setting body for Fi360. The AIF designation signifies specialized knowledge of fiduciary responsibility and the ability to implement policies and procedures that meet a defined standard of care. The designation is the culmination of a rigorous training program, which includes a comprehensive, closed-book final examination under the supervision of a proctor, and agreement to abide by the Center’s Code of Ethics and Conduct Standards. On an ongoing basis, completion of continuing education and adherence to the Code of Ethics and Conduct Standards are required to maintain the AIF designation.
Van Houten a resident of Oakdale, CA is CEO of American Asset & Wealth Management with its’ main office in Riverbank which serves clients throughout Northern California. Van Houten specializes in Insurance & Investments with a focus on Retirement Planning.
Van Houten is a Financial Advisor and an Investment Advisor Representative through Cetera Advisor Networks LLC and sees clients in his branch office in Riverbank as well as branch offices in Concord and Rancho Cordova by appointment.
About Fi360
Fi360, a fiduciary education, training and technology company, helps financial intermediaries use prudent fiduciary practices to profitably gather, grow and protect investors’ assets. Since 1999, the firm has provided financial professionals with the tools necessary to act as a fiduciary in their work with investors. Headquartered in Pittsburgh, PA, Fi360 is the home of the Accredited Investment Fiduciary® (AIF®) designation, the Fiduciary Focus Toolkit™ and the Fi360 Fiduciary Score®.
